Sustained-Release Dextroamphetamine Formulation and Drug Disposition

The development of prolonged-release dexamphetamine compositions hinges on sophisticated delivery technologies aimed at achieving a gradual clinical effect over an extended time. Typically, these formulations utilize a combination of matrices, such as water-attracting and water-resistant ingredients, to regulate the pharmaceutical diffusion rate. Drug disposition profiles are significantly altered compared to instant-release versions. Following dosing, dexamphetamine is gradually released, resulting in a lesser peak plasma concentration and a extended period to reach maximum effect. This pattern reduces the potential for undesirable outcomes associated with sudden drug intensities while maintaining sufficient symptom treatment throughout the period. Absorption rate can also be affected by factors like nutrition and gastrointestinal movement.

Addressing Unwanted Effects of Extended-Release Dexamphetamine

While long-acting dexamphetamine medication can effectively manage attention-deficit/hyperactivity disorder, it's important to be aware of likely adverse reactions. Frequently experienced occurrences might feature a temporary decrease in hunger, problems drifting off to sleep, or sensations of agitation. Certain individuals, there could be slight digestive discomfort or rare cephalalgia. It is advise communicating whatever recurring or troubling symptoms with your physician to consider alternative strategies, which may such as adjusting the dosage or supplementing with other therapies. Note that effective handling of unwanted effects is vital for maintaining general quality of life.

Dexamphetamine XR: Dosage and Adjustment Strategies

Initiating dexamphetamine extended-release treatment requires careful assessment and a stepwise titration approach to minimize adverse effects and maximize therapeutic efficacy. The initial baseline prescription typically ranges from 5 milligrams per morning, though this can vary based on the patient's years, weight, concurrent medical problems, and previous response to therapy. Later, the healthcare professional may cautiously augment the amount in small steps, generally no faster than once week, as closely observing for therapeutic effects and any signs of adverse reaction. Ultimately, individual patient response should guide the adjustment process, always prioritizing safety and effectiveness.
